2014-2015 American Studies Art and Photo Prize
In an increasingly online world, the field of American Studies remains committed to studying material culture. In our popular “Objects and Everyday Life” class, students learn about how to learn about things, whether that’s the Barbie doll, the Lawn, or the bra.
In that spirit, AMS is sponsoring an Art contest, limited to AMS majors, minors or those who have taken AMS classes to paint an object that we purchased from the UC Davis Bargain Barn
Sketch out a concept (with colors) and AMS faculty will choose one winner. The winning entry will receive $75 gift certificate to the UCD bookstore and the object will featured on the AMS website. We will pay for $75 in art materials, as long as they can be purchased from the bookstore. With those materials, you can actualize your vision in time for the AMS spring graduation party and write a short paragraph explaining the concept which we will also feature on the website.
In addition, we are asking for images to be added to the AMS home page that best “represent America and/or American Studies at UC Davis.” AMS faculty will choose the top 10 images submitted, and you will receive $10 Bookstore gift card if we select your image. If chosen, your photo will be added to the website banner. Each person is limited to 2 entries, and by submitting the photo, you release the photo to be used on the website. Photos should be sent as Jpegs, 900 W x 600 H (i.e., 3:2 aspect ratio)
